Key Features of High-Security Registration Plates:

  1. Holographic Technology:

  2. One of the hallmark features of HSRP is the integration of holographic technology. The use of holograms adds a layer of complexity to the plates, making it exceedingly difficult for counterfeiters to replicate or tamper with them.

  3. Holographic images or features, often incorporated into the background of the plate, serve as a visual verification tool, allowing law enforcement and other authorities to quickly authenticate the plate's legitimacy.


  4. Chromium-based Security Inscription:

  5. HSRPs often feature a chromium-based security inscription that includes the name of the registering authority. This special inscription is resistant to tampering and alteration, providing an additional layer of security against fraudulent activities related

  6. to license plates.

  7. Embossed Border and Letters:

  8. Unlike conventional license plates with flat printed characters, HSRPs utilize embossed borders and letters. The raised characters not only enhance the aesthetic appeal of the plates but also make it significantly harder for individuals to alter the information on the plate.

  9. The tactile nature of the embossed features adds a

  10. physical dimension to the security measures.

  11. Unique Identification Number:

  12. Each High-Security Registration Plate is assigned a unique identification number. This number is more than just a random combination of digits; it serves as a key to a centralized database containing detailed information about the registered vehicle. This linkage between the physical plate and digital records enhances traceability and facilitates efficient law enforcement.


  13. Color-Coded Stickers: Some jurisdictions incorporate color-coded stickers on HSRPs to provide additional information about the vehicle, such as its fuel type. These stickers serve as a quick visual cue for law enforcement officers and other authorities, contributing to effective traffic management and enforcement.


  14. Security Screws and Snap Locks:

  15. The physical attachment of HSRPs to vehicles is secured using specialized security screws and snap locks. These fastening mechanisms are designed to resist tampering and

  16. deter theft, ensuring that the plates remain affixed to the designated vehicle.

  17. Database Integration:

  18. HSRPs are not standalone identifiers; they are integral components of a larger system that includes centralized databases managed by registering authorities. This integration ensures that the information on the plates is synchronized with the digital records, allowing for real-time verification and monitoring of registered vehicles.

Significance of High-Security Registration Plates:

  1. Prevention of Vehicle Theft:

  2. HSRPs act as a powerful deterrent against vehicle theft. The unique identification numbers, holographic features, and other security measures make it extremely challenging for criminals to steal vehicles and replace license plates without detection.


  3. Counterfeit Prevention:

  4. The advanced security features of HSRPs make them resistant to counterfeiting. Governments and law enforcement agencies benefit from a standardized and secure identification system that reduces the likelihood of fraudulent activities such as using fake plates.


  5. Enhanced Road Safety:

  6. The integration of color-coded stickers on HSRPs contributes to enhanced road safety. Quick visual identification of a vehicle's fuel type can be critical in emergency situations or for regulatory purposes, allowing authorities to respond appropriately.


  7. Streamlined Law Enforcement:

  8. HSRPs streamline law enforcement efforts by providing a reliable and standardized method of identifying vehicles. The unique identification numbers and database integration facilitate quick verification, aiding law enforcement officers in their duties.


  9. Effective Traffic Management:

  10. The color-coded stickers and other features on HSRPs contribute to effective traffic management. Authorities can quickly identify and categorize vehicles based on visual cues,

  11. supporting efforts to regulate traffic flow and enforce relevant laws.

  12. Standardization Across Jurisdictions:

  13. The adoption of HSRPs promotes standardization across jurisdictions. A unified system of vehicle identification reduces administrative complexities, facilitates interstate cooperation, and contributes to a more seamless experience for both authorities and vehicle owners.

Implementation Challenges and Solutions:

While the adoption of High-Security Registration Plates brings numerous benefits, the implementation of such a system is not without challenges. Some common challenges include resistance from the public, logistical issues, and the need for significant infrastructure upgrades.

However, these challenges can be addressed through effective communication, public awareness campaigns, and phased implementation strategies.

  1. Public Awareness Campaigns:

  2. Successful implementation of HSRPs requires proactive public awareness campaigns. Informing the public about the benefits of the new system, addressing concerns, and explaining the role of HSRPs in enhancing security and safety can garner support and

  3. cooperation.

  4. Phased Implementation:

  5. To mitigate logistical challenges, governments can consider a phased implementation approach. Rolling out HSRPs gradually, starting with specific regions or vehicle categories, allows authorities to address challenges incrementally and fine-tune the implementation

  6. process.

  7. Collaboration with Stakeholders:

  8. Collaboration with stakeholders, including vehicle manufacturers, dealerships, and law enforcement agencies, is crucial for the successful implementation of HSRPs. Involving these key players in the planning and execution stages ensures a coordinated effort and reduces

  9. potential roadblocks.

  10. Investment in Infrastructure:

  11. Governments may need to invest in upgrading infrastructure to support the implementation of HSRPs. This includes the development of centralized databases, technology for plate production, and training for law enforcement personnel. Long-term benefits, such as reduced vehicle-related crimes, justify these initial investments.
